Gravity of Domestic Violence Against Women
Domestic violence in India has always remained an entrenched problem, and it has only been exacerbated in the recent years. About 70% of women in India are victims of domestic violence. National Crime Records Bureau’s (NCRB) ‘Crime in India’ 2019 report was highly worrisome, yet not startling. As per the report, in India, a woman is raped every sixteen minutes, and every four minutes, she experiences cruelty at the hands of her in-laws.[2] An estimated 99.1% of sexual violence cases are unreported, and in most such instances, the perpetrator is the husband of the victim.
